A dog in heat refers to a female dog that is fertile and ready to mate. It’s a stage in your dog’s reproductive cycle when she’s ovulating, so she’s open to potential mates. Why Your Dog’s Paws Are Turning Brown
Why Are My Dog’s Paws Turning Brown? In most cases, the colour change in your dog’s paws is largely due to overlicking. This tends to happen when your dog’s saliva comes into contact too often with its fur coat. But, why exactly is your dog licking its paws?
